Why You Must Routinely Take Full System Image Backups of Your Computer
As a computer owner, and particularly if you’ve been using your computer (or a succession of computers, moving your data along) for years, the most valuable thing you have is not the computer itself, but the information – the data – you have on it.
If you do not take full system image backups, you could lose everything at a moment’s notice.
Things that can cause data loss include:
1. Drive failure (and attempts to recover data from a conventional hard disk drive [HDD] runs into the hundreds of dollars, minimum, and from a solid-state drive [SSD] you can multiply that by ten. And there’s a decent chance that recovery will not even be possible).
2. Ransomware – Everyone thinks “that can’t happen to me,” but the news indicates, repeatedly, that it absolutely can.
3. Malware of various sorts including viruses, worms, and more.
